Crime Doesn’t Fly Act of 2022

United States117th CongressS-3536Senate
Updated: Jan 31, 2022

Summary

Crime Doesn't Fly Act of 2022 This bill prohibits the use of warrants for the arrest, removal, or deportation of an alien as proof of identity at an airport security checkpoint unless the alien is being removed from the United States pursuant to immigration laws.
